Google Pixel 9 Pro vs Asus ROG Phone 8:  If you need a flagship smartphone, then Google Pixel 9 Pro and Asus ROG Phone 8 are two of the most powerful phones. Both of them have top-notch displays, robust cameras, and high-performance processors. Their use is different, though—Pixel 9 Pro emphasizes camera and software, whereas ROG Phone 8 is built for gaming.

Pixel 9 Pro is small in size with a 6.3-inch OLED screen, whereas ROG Phone 8 has a bigger 6.78-inch AMOLED screen with an increased refresh rate. Battery life, charging rate, and camera configuration are also different. Let’s compare both phones to determine which one is best for you.

Google Pixel 9 Pro

Pixel 9 Pro is driven by the Google Tensor G4 chipset, an octa-core processor with a 3.1GHz clock speed. It features 16GB RAM and 256GB of internal storage. Although it’s not the fastest processor, Google optimizes the software to ensure smooth performance.

it comes with a 6.3-inch LTPO OLED screen that measures 1280×2856 pixels. The display is compatible with a 120Hz refresh rate and provides a peak brightness of up to 3000 nits. It is covered with Corning Gorilla Glass Victus 2.

Pixel 9 Pro features a triple-camera system with a 50MP main sensor, 48MP ultra-wide-angle lens, and 48MP telephoto lens with OIS. It supports 8K video recording at 30fps and a 42MP front camera.

It has a 4700mAh battery, 27W fast charging, 21W wireless charging, and reverse wireless charging. The phone operates on Android v14 and can be upgraded to v15.

Asus ROG Phone 8

ROG Phone 8 is a gaming phone with the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 chipset, a 3.3GHz octa-core processor. It comes with 12GB RAM and 256GB internal storage for a fast gaming experience.

It features a larger 6.78-inch LTPO AMOLED display with a resolution of 1080×2400 pixels. The refresh rate is 165Hz, making it one of the smoothest displays available. With HDR10 support and 2500 nits peak brightness, visuals appear sharp and clear.

Asus ROG Phone 8 includes a 50MP main sensor, a 13MP ultra-wide lens, and a 5MP macro lens with OIS. The front camera is a 32MP Sony IMX890 sensor, offering good selfies.

It has a 5500mAh battery with fast charging support at 65W, 15W wireless charging, and reverse charging of 10W. It uses Android v14, coupled with game-specific software enhancements.
